Reports to: House Proceedings ManagerPurpose:To assist with House business i.e. Table Duty; provide support to the Gauteng Provincial Legislature on Standing Rules; undertake Parliamentary research papers for the purposes of developing and enhancing Parliamentary systems; manage Stakeholders with regards to the development and understanding of the Standing Rules and manage the sub-unit in Special Operations and Research.CompetenciesAnalytical Thinking: the ability to analyze a situation, collecting and evaluating available data, identifying and solving the problem.Organizational Ability: allocate human, financial, and other resources such as time and equipment according to goals and objectives; evaluating progress against plan and adapting resources to changing situations.Flexibility: recognizes the merit of new ideas, the willingness to move from one''s own and adapt to new ideas according to available information.Goal Directed: focused on the achievement of goals set by one''s self or the organization.Proactive: the inclination and nature to take responsibility and action, without having to be told; to respond to the situation, having considered the long term purpose, goals and objectives.Customer Service Excellence (Internal & External): Demonstrating awareness and commitment to identifying customer expectations and strives towards continuously exceeding them.Assertive: assert his/her authority in a decisive, influential manner in order to produce customer-orientated outputs without arousing hostility or aggression.Team Work: Display sound interpersonal relations & ability to work in a team.Work under pressure: Able to work under pressure.Knowledge and skillsDemonstrate superior ability to interpret statutes and display consistency in the interpretation. Communicate important legal considerations to all stakeholders.Demonstrate an ability to write legal opinion.In depth understanding of parliamentary procedures and the Standing Rules of the House; display the ability to interpret procedural documents and apply it in a consistent, but intelligent manner; ability to contribute towards procedural development.Managerial Skills (day to day activities): develop goal achievement and co-operation through guidance on objectives and utilization of available resources; manage people effectively using constructive interventions where neededExcellent general knowledge of current local and foreign affairs, particularly political affairs.Computer literate in the use of the Gauteng Legislature''s chosen word processing package and software used for information gathering and internal communication.Excellent verbal and written communication skills (in English).Key Performance AreasKPA 1: Table DutyTo assist in the preparation of House PublicationsPrepare briefing notes and rapidly find precedents in response to urgent requests on procedural points.Advise the Presiding officer regarding procedural matters prior to and whilst the House is in sitting.Deal with amendments brought to the table by members.Advise the Presiding Officer if individuals are out of order.Collate rulings made by Presiding Officers and prepare a Precedents Book.KPA 2: Procedural Services to CommitteesServe in an advisory capacity to the Committees of the Gauteng Provincial Legislature.Attend meetings of the above-mentioned Committees on an ongoing basis.Prepare briefing documents for the Committees as and when tasked to do so by the Chairperson.Provide Procedural advice to the Chairpersons and the Committees during meetings.Research problem areas and prepare proposals in relation to matters within the jurisdiction of these Committees.
